Beyond their impact on grip strength, CrossFit rings are renowned for their ability to elevate coordination and balance. The unstable nature of the rings challenges your neuromuscular system, forcing it to work harder to maintain stability and control. This constant adaptation leads to enhanced coordination, enabling you to perform complex movements with greater precision and fluidity. Improved balance is another significant benefit of CrossFit ring exercises. As you navigate the dynamic movements on the rings, your body is required to constantly adjust and maintain equilibrium. This continuous challenge strengthens your core muscles and improves your overall sense of balance, translating into better stability in everyday activities and sports.

2. Essential Ring Exercises for Beginners

Essential Ring Exercises for Beginners: Lay the Foundation for Your CrossFit Ring Journey with Beginner-Friendly Exercises Designed to Build a Solid Base.

As you embark on your CrossFit ring adventure, it’s crucial to establish a strong foundation with beginner-friendly exercises that will prepare you for more advanced movements. These exercises are designed to build a solid base of strength, stability, and coordination, ensuring that you progress safely and effectively.

One fundamental exercise for beginners is the ring row. This exercise targets the back, shoulders, and arms, helping to develop pulling strength and improve posture. Start by positioning yourself under the rings with your feet shoulder-width apart. Grasp the rings with an overhand grip, slightly wider than shoulder-width, and lean back until your body forms a straight line from head to heels. Pull yourself up towards the rings, keeping your core engaged and your elbows close to your body. Lower yourself back down with control.

Another essential exercise for beginners is the ring push-up. This variation of the classic push-up challenges your stability and engages your core muscles. Start by placing the rings shoulder-width apart on the ground. Position yourself in a plank position with your hands on the rings and your body in a straight line from head to heels. Bend your elbows to lower your chest towards the rings, keeping your core tight and your elbows close to your body. Push yourself back up to the starting position, maintaining control throughout the movement.

5. Tips for Maximizing Your Ring Workouts

Tips for Maximizing Your Ring Workouts: Unlock the Full Potential of Your Ring Workouts with Expert Tips on Proper Technique, Safety Measures, and Strategies for Continued Progress.

To maximize the effectiveness of your ring workouts and ensure continued progress, it’s essential to follow proper techniques, adhere to safety measures, and implement strategies that will help you reach your fitness goals. Here are some expert tips to help you get the most out of your ring workouts:

  1. Master Proper Technique: Optimal form is paramount when performing ring exercises. Maintain a neutral spine, engage your core, and focus on controlled movements to minimize the risk of injury and maximize results. Seek guidance from experienced trainers or coaches to ensure you’re executing exercises correctly.

  2. Prioritize Safety: Safety should always be your top priority. Inspect your rings and ensure they are securely fastened before each workout. Use a spotter for challenging exercises, especially when attempting new movements. Listen to your body and rest when needed to prevent overexertion and injuries.

  3. Incorporate Variety: To avoid plateaus and target different muscle groups, incorporate a variety of exercises into your ring workouts. Include exercises that focus on pulling, pushing, and core stability. Regularly switch up your routines to challenge your body and stimulate continued growth.
